生产制备方法及用途展开↓

制备方法


能与Hedgehog信号通路中的Smoothened(Smo)蛋白结合,从而抑制该蛋白活性。因其致畸作用而于20世纪60年代被发现,但九十年代以后的研究表明,环巴胺是一种hedgehog信号通路抑制剂,已经在在果蝇体中得到证实,由于hedgehog信号通路的突变与多种肿瘤的发病有关联,最近研究发现,环巴胺在成体中具有抗肿瘤作用,且在胰腺癌、胆管癌、卵巢癌、肝癌等的体内或体外实验中均得到证实,但关于其在胃癌细胞中的研究,国内尚未见相关报道。目前环巴胺作为一种潜在的抗肿瘤新药在世界范围内掀起了研究热潮。

毒理学数据:

1、急性毒性:小鼠口径LDLo180 mg/kg;仓鼠口径LDLo170 mg/kg

2、   繁殖性:大鼠(120毫克/ kgSEX /时间:女性6-9天后受孕)口径TDLo;小鼠TDLo300 mg/kgSEX/DURATION : female 10 day(s) after conception;兔子口径TDLo44500 ug/kgSEX/DURATION : female 7 day(s) after conception
